Can You Take Mucuna Pruriens and Valerian Root Together?

Use extra care with this pair

The short answer

Valerian Root has partial agonist activity at serotonin 5-HT5a receptors, and Mucuna Pruriens also modulates serotonergic pathways. Combining them may produce additive serotonergic effects.

How to arrange timing

Monitor for excessive sedation or serotonin-related symptoms when combining Valerian Root with Mucuna Pruriens.

Reference

Reference noted for this combination: Dietz BM, et al. Valerian extract and valerenic acid are partial agonists of the 5-HT5a receptor in vitro. Mol Brain Res. 2005;138(2):191-197.
